Czech Republic - Employment in Agriculture, Forestry and Seafood
Since 2014, Czech Republic Employment in Agriculture, Forestry and Seafood was down by 1.5% year on year. In 2019, the country was number 3 comparing other countries in Employment in Agriculture, Forestry and Seafood with 107.81 Thousand Full-Time Equivalent. Czech Republic is overtaken by France, which was number 2 with 326 Thousand Full-Time Equivalent and is followed by South Korea with 105.2 Thousand Full-Time Equivalent. Italy lead the ranking with 446.5 Thousand Full-Time Equivalent in 2019, stable versus 2018. Norway witnessed the best average annual growth at +2.5% per year, while South Korea was the worst growing country at -2.1% per year.
